South Sudan’s decision to accept Palestinians from Gaza — while many wealthy Arab states remain reluctant — is striking for both political and symbolic reasons.

Here’s the layered significance:

1. A Sharp Contrast in Moral Posture

  • South Sudan is one of the world’s poorest and most conflict-affected countries, yet it is extending humanitarian refuge to people in crisis.

  • Wealthy Arab Gulf states — with vast resources, modern infrastructure, and cultural-religious ties to Palestinians — have largely refrained from taking refugees, citing “security,” “political,” or “regional stability” concerns.

  • This flips the expected moral hierarchy: those with the least are showing the most.

2. Political & Historical Irony

  • South Sudan is not Arab, and its own history is shaped by decades of war with Sudan’s Arab-dominated north — the very Sudan that once aligned itself with the Palestinian cause.

  • By opening its doors, South Sudan is separating humanitarian principles from geopolitical alliances, while some Arab states are letting politics override solidarity.

3. Undercutting the “Brotherhood” Narrative

  • The Arab League and many Middle Eastern governments have long used the Palestinian cause as a rhetorical pillar of unity.

  • Yet, when faced with an actual chance to share the human burden, some avoid it, exposing a gap between political slogans and humanitarian action.

  • South Sudan’s move quietly calls out this inconsistency.

4. Soft Power and International Image

  • For South Sudan, this gesture can build moral capital and diplomatic goodwill internationally — showing itself as a responsible, compassionate actor despite its own challenges.

  • It also signals to African and non-Arab states that moral leadership is not tied to wealth or geopolitical status.

5. Wider African Solidarity

  • Across parts of Africa, there’s a growing recognition that humanitarianism shouldn’t be hostage to regional politics.

  • South Sudan’s acceptance of Gazans can be seen as part of Africa’s tradition of receiving refugees from distant crises (e.g., Uganda hosting South Sudanese, Rwanda hosting Congolese).
